The "Morioka Fireworks Festival" (盛岡花火の祭典), which brilliantly adorns Morioka's summer night sky, is the largest fireworks display in the Morioka area, featuring a competition of large-scale "shakudama" (尺玉) fireworks by pyrotechnicians from across Japan and impressive wide starmines. Staged along the Kitakami River (北上川) riverbed downstream from the Tonan Ohashi Bridge (都南大橋), approximately 10,000 elaborately crafted fireworks are launched over about one hour, captivating all visitors.
Event Overview
| Item | Detail |
|---|---|
| Date | Tuesday, August 11, 2026 (public holiday) |
| Time | Gates open 4:30 PM, Fireworks 7:25 PM – 8:30 PM (approx. 65 minutes) |
| Venue | Kitakami River riverbed downstream from Tonan Ohashi Bridge (都南大橋), Morioka City (盛岡市), Iwate Prefecture (岩手県) |
| Number of Fireworks | Approx. 10,000 (based on past performance). The number of fireworks for 2026 has not been disclosed. |
| Annual Attendance | Approx. 76,500 people (2025 actual) |
| In case of rain | Held rain or shine, canceled in case of severe weather (no postponement). In case of cancellation, an announcement will be made by around 1:00 PM on Monday, August 10, via the official X (formerly Twitter) account and IBC Radio (IBCラジオ). |
Venue and Map
The venue for the Morioka Fireworks Festival is the Kitakami River riverbed downstream from the Tonan Ohashi Bridge (都南大橋) in Morioka City (盛岡市). A key feature is the close proximity of the viewing seats to the launch site, allowing visitors to experience the power and excitement up close. You can enjoy a diverse program, including a competition of "shakudama" (尺玉) fireworks by pyrotechnicians from all over Japan, and "shakudama" fireworks that can only be seen at this festival in the Morioka area.
Access
The area around the venue becomes extremely crowded, so using public transportation is highly recommended.
By Train/Bus
- JR Iwate-Ioka Station (JR岩手飯岡駅): Approximately a 30-minute walk from the East Exit to the venue.
- Shuttle Bus: A paid shuttle bus service operates from the East Exit of Iwate-Ioka Station to the venue (in front of the Japanese Red Cross Society, Nisseki-mae). The fare is 400 JPY (approx. $2.67 USD) for adults and 200 JPY (approx. $1.33 USD) for children one-way. For outbound journeys, temporary buses run between 5:00 PM and 7:00 PM, timed with train arrivals. For return journeys, temporary buses run sequentially between 8:30 PM and 9:10 PM.
- As a special return train service, a temporary train will depart Iwate-Ioka Station at 9:25 PM, arriving at Morioka Station (盛岡駅) at 9:35 PM.
- JR Morioka Station (JR盛岡駅): Route buses operate from Morioka Station to the vicinity of the venue (Nisseki-mae bus stop). The journey takes approximately 30 minutes, with a one-way fare of 470 JPY (approx. $3.13 USD) for adults and 240 JPY (approx. $1.60 USD) for children. Temporary buses will also operate on the day, with special buses from Morioka Station to Nisseki-mae running non-stop.
- Typically, buses are extremely crowded between 4:00 PM and 5:00 PM, and traffic congestion may cause delays. Therefore, it is recommended to use buses earlier, between 2:00 PM and 3:00 PM.
By Car
- From the Tohoku Expressway Morioka-Minami Interchange (東北自動車道盛岡南IC), it's approximately a 15-minute drive towards National Route 4 (国道4号線).
- Parking: There is no parking available at the venue itself, but special temporary parking lots will be provided.
- Morioka Central Wholesale Market (盛岡市中央卸売市場) (400 spaces, shuttle bus departure/arrival point)
- Morioka City Tonan Culture Hall (盛岡市都南文化会館) (200 spaces)
- Jam Friend Morioka-Minami Store (ジャムフレンド盛岡南店) (250 spaces, along a section of the road)
- Each parking lot is available from 3:30 PM to 10:00 PM. Please note that parking spaces are limited and may become full.
- Traffic Restrictions: Vehicle access will be restricted between 6:00 PM and 9:30 PM in the area around the venue (from Morioka-Minami I.C. Entrance Intersection to National Route 396 (国道396号) Tonan Ohashi East Embankment Intersection, and Fureai Land Iwate (ふれあいランド岩手) front street).
